According to the FAQ this is an upgrade;
What will be required for product upgrade to a new version?

The following information may be required for product upgrades (i.e. from Splash PRO to Splash PRO Export): PRODUCT SERIAL NUMBER, MIRILLIS TRANSACTION ID, CUSTOMER E-MAIL. All of this information is sent by Mirillis in product purchase confirmation e-mail. You must keep this e-mail for your records, as it contains required information not only for product upgrades but also to obtain customer and technical support.
